The new provisions of the UAE government allow the resident, whether he is an employee or an employer (investor), and holds a valid residency, to sponsor members of his immediate family, including the wife and male children under the age of 18, and unmarried daughters.
If a resident seeks to change the status of his family and children from that of a temporary entry permit to that of a residence visa, he is required to finish the processes for changing his status within a maximum period of two months from the date that his wife and children entered the UAE.
